Created by the Stars, Loved by the Skies - The Sky's Future - Chapter 4: The World's Answer - Episode 1

Through Lyria's recounting of the War, Satyr learns that Freyr was friends with Baldr and invites him to join them in looking for a way to wake up primal beasts slumbering in core form. Rosetta remarks that she sympathizes with the resignation Freyr must feel but also hopes mortals and primals can work together toward a brighter future.
